In the District Court of Kasulu at Kasulu, without prior
consent and certificate of the DPP, the Appellant and another were jointly
arraigned for offences preferred in three (3) counts namely; 1st
count of unlawful possession of firearms, 2nd count of unlawful
possession of psychotropic substance and 3rd count of unlawful
possession of firearms and ammunitions. The Appellant was convicted as charged
on the first two counts and was sentenced to serve fifteen (15) and ten (10)
years’ imprisonment, respectively, on the 1st and 2nd
counts. Realizing that he was late in appealing within the said prescribed
period, the Appellant correctly lodged an application in the High Court for
enlargement of time to appeal out of time. The High Court heard the application
on merit and dismissed it. The Appellant is presently appealing against that
decision of the first appellate court.
